Common local problems in North Las Vegas

Dust and grit accumulation

Dry, dusty conditions common in this climate zone can work into tracks and rollers, increasing friction and wear over time.

Heat-driven opener and seal wear

Intense sun exposure and sustained high temperatures dry out rubber weatherstripping and can degrade opener lubricants faster than in milder climates.

Thermal expansion on tracks and hardware

Large day-to-night temperature swings cause metal tracks and hardware to expand and contract, which can gradually affect alignment.
